Nice one, cheers! So what are they worth generally speaking...?
That really is a "how long is a piece of string" question mate.
The trouble is.... there were LOTS of types of pro-class bars.
The original stainless steel mongoose stamped ones, the chrome mongoose stamped ones, the chrome unstamped ones, pro size, expert size, christ they even made steel ones ! ;D
And the real problem is the standard ebay buyer knows nothing of this - just sees "Pro Class bars" in the title and the right shape and pow ! in goes the bid :laugh:
I've seen the much desired stainless bars sell for £40 and the crapest of the crap steel bars sell for £80 and all kinds of in between stuff sell for £20 - £120 so place your bets......
Ebay is your roll of the dice or let someone offer you an amount on here if you are thinking of selling them - good luck ! :10_2_12: :LolLolLolLol:
